Pattern: Thousands with a silent tens place
2,408 splits into 2 | 408. In the final group, the tens place is zero, so “eight” follows “four hundred” directly.
| Digit | Position | Value | Value in words |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 | thousands | 2,000 | two thousand |
| 4 | hundreds | 400 | four hundred |
| 0 | tens | 0 | not spoken |
| 8 | ones | 8 | eight |
| Group | Digits | Reading |
|---|---|---|
| thousands | 2 | two thousand |
| final group | 408 | four hundred eight |
2,408 splits into 2 | 408. In the final group, the tens place is zero, so “eight” follows “four hundred” directly.
The comma boundary separates 2 from 408: “two thousand” is read before “four hundred eight”.
The tens position contains zero. It preserves place value in the numeral but adds no spoken word.
The American English style used here normally omits “and” between “hundred” and the following tens or ones.
